Ingredients for Cultured or Fermented vegetables, fresh organic green cabbage, red cabbage, coarsely chopped. Water and salt fermentation method known as using brine, a method of food preservation. Food is high in probiotics, micro-organisms that promote healthy gut bacteria called intestinal flora. Eat daily for good health. Delicious side dish for lunch or dinner.
